When, back in the spring, we were looking for somewhere to stay in Lisbon, we immediately settled on Solar do Castelo on the strength of the recommendations it received online. We've just returned from our stay, which was for a week, and we were not disappointed. If anything, all the praise which other reporters have heaped on the hotel has understated its sheer distinction. I think it's quite simply the best hotel that my wife and I have ever stayed in. For a start, its setting is magical, within the outer walls of the castle, and with the castle's peacocks popping in and out. Then there are all the special touches that set it apart - tea, coffee and pastries available in the lounge all day long, sparkling wine served in the lounge as part of the room rate, and a decanter of port on the table in your room for your nightcap. And there's the hotel's ambience, with its lovely buildings and its attractive courtyard, where you can sit or lounge while you read a book or sip your coffee. And, above all, there are the staff, whose charm, courtesy, friendliness and attentiveness are all beyond description. Just one small example: on our first morning, when I came down for breakfast and wanted to make tea, I asked for a teapot, which I much prefer to making it in a cup or mug. Every morning thereafter, the lovely lady who looks after breakfast made sure there was a pot for me. And she always greeted me with a smile and a cheery 'good morning'. To all of you at Solae do Castelo, may wife and I say a warm 'thank you' - you are wonderful. And I recommend this hotel to anyone visiting Lisbon.
